Avenida Chile XII 2024

Bogotá · 16 June 2024 · 5 events · 46 competitors · 42 personal bests

Michael Andres Castillo Lemus won two of the five events (3×3, 4×4) and the closest final was the 2×2, won by Juan Sebastian Mendez Llanos by 0.19 seconds. 46 competitors produced 42 personal bests, 11 of which still stand today, and one people held a competitor card for the first time.

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a final is a competition's last round; its order decides the podium ·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· every solve starts from a computer-generated scramble, the same for every competitor in a round.
